What are the signs of bad brake rotors?

  • Vibration or pulsing through the brake pedal or steering wheel during braking.
  • Visible scoring, grooves, or blue discoloration on the rotor surface.

What is the difference between resurfacing and replacing brake rotors?

  • Resurfacing smooths the existing rotor face to remove minor grooves and restore even braking; it’s cost-effective when thickness and runout are within spec.
  • Replacement is required if the rotor is below minimum thickness, severely warped, or cracked—new rotors restore full OEM performance.

Front and Rear Brake Rotors

Understanding the difference between front and rear rotors on a 2026 Ram 1500 REV helps you prioritize repairs and budget for service. Front rotors typically handle more braking force and heat dissipation because braking weight shifts forward; they often wear faster than rear rotors, especially in heavy stop-and-go city driving or towing. Common rotor issues for the 2026 Ram 1500 REV include warping (causing pedal pulsation), deep scoring (from debris or worn pads), and rim-to-rotor corrosion. Left unaddressed, these problems can damage calipers, cause uneven pad wear, trigger ABS warnings, and reduce stopping power—each escalating repair costs and downtime. At Larry H.
